Maintaining Proper Weight and Fitness Level is Vital to Preventing Chronic Pain

Physicians at Advanced Pain Management in Greenfield, Wis., say maintaining proper weight and a basic level of fitness is essential to protecting the spine and joints from excessive strain as well as preventing chronic painful conditions, according to a news release.

Advertisement

Advanced Pain Management also says overweight patients are at greater risk for lower back pain, sleep disorders, spinal disc pain and joint pain due to weight-related strain on the spine and joints.
